Hi guys, I'm Planning my kitchen floor and just wanted to know what prep to do b4 tiling it. It's a solid concrete floor do I need to put down ply? Or can I just prime it and thn tile? What would u pros do? Cheers
 
T

The Legend; Phil Hobson RIP

Hi you can prime and tile a concrete floor, but imo they are rarely flat enough. I would be tempted to use a self leveling compound. Hope this helps:thumbsup:
 
D

DHTiling

Hi.

You need to check the floor for Flatness.. use a straight edge or 2mtr level etc..

Lay this on the floor and move it about checking for dips and rises.. anything deeper than 3mm will need correcting and the use of an appropriate levelling compound will rectify this.

Your aim is to get the floor flat and ready to accept the choice of tile.
 
D

DHTiling

Why ply a concrete floor... you are just adding expansion issues to a solid floor.

Just prep and tile..:)
